The fourth trimester, often called the postpartum period, is a crucial time when both your body and mind adjust to life after birth. During this phase, your body undergoes significant changes as it recovers from labor and begins to realign itself. You might feel exhausted, overwhelmed, or even a little emotional—these feelings are normal. Prioritizing postpartum recovery is essential, so give yourself permission to rest, stay hydrated, and listen to your body’s signals. Healing takes time, and each day you’ll notice small improvements, whether it’s less pain, more energy, or better sleep.

This period is also about forging a bond with your newborn. Bonding techniques play a vital role in establishing that deep connection, which benefits both you and your baby. Skin-to-skin contact is one of the most effective methods; holding your baby close helps regulate their heart rate, temperature, and breathing while releasing oxytocin, the bonding hormone. As you cuddle your newborn, you reinforce feelings of safety and trust. Eye contact is another powerful technique—look into their eyes and speak softly. This interaction not only soothes your baby but also helps you become more attuned to their cues and needs.

Breastfeeding, if you choose to do it, is a natural way to foster bonding. It encourages closeness and provides comfort, especially during those early days when your baby is adjusting to the world outside the womb. Even if you’re not breastfeeding, holding, rocking, or gently massaging your baby helps build that essential emotional connection. Consistent physical contact reassures your newborn and helps you both feel more secure amid the chaos of new parenthood.
